This transfer is possible in two ways: direct transfer and using the decimal system.
first, let\'s make a direct transfer.
let\'s do a direct translation from binary to hexadecimal like this:
10100100111100102 = 1010 0100 1111 0010 = 1010(=A) 0100(=4) 1111(=F) 0010(=2) = A4F216
answer: 10100100111100102 = A4F216
now let\'s make the transfer using the decimal system.
let\'s translate to decimal like this:
1∙215+0∙214+1∙213+0∙212+0∙211+1∙210+0∙29+0∙28+1∙27+1∙26+1∙25+1∙24+0∙23+0∙22+1∙21+0∙20 = 1∙32768+0∙16384+1∙8192+0∙4096+0∙2048+1∙1024+0∙512+0∙256+1∙128+1∙64+1∙32+1∙16+0∙8+0∙4+1∙2+0∙1 = 32768+0+8192+0+0+1024+0+0+128+64+32+16+0+0+2+0 = 4222610
got It: 10100100111100102 =4222610
